Progressive rollout with quality gates at each stage:
| Stage | Traffic | Duration | Gate Criteria |
|---|---|---|---|
| Shadow | 0% live (mirror only) | 1 hour | No crashes, latency within 20% of baseline |
| Canary | 5% | 30 min | p95 latency within 15% of baseline, error rate <1% |
| Expand | 25% | 2 hours | Groundedness regression <5%, relevance regression <5% |
| Majority | 50% | 4 hours | Cost, latency, and quality remain within agreed SLOs |
| Full | 100% | — | Promote, drain old revision |
Abort at any stage if quality drops. Never skip shadow validation for LLM model swaps.
| Factor | Blue-Green | Canary |
|---|---|---|
| Model version bump (GPT-4o → 4.1) | ✅ Full cutover after shadow test | — |
| Prompt/config change | — | ✅ Gradual with A/B metrics |
| Infrastructure change (new region) | ✅ Swap slots atomically | — |
| Fine-tuned model rollout | — | ✅ Monitor groundedness drift |
| Latency-sensitive (voice, real-time) | ✅ Instant rollback | — |
| RAG pipeline change | — | ✅ Compare retrieval quality |

exit $FAILRoute users to different model deployments using feature flags:
# config/feature-flags.json — consumed by App Configuration
{
"model_routing": {
"enabled": true,
"variants": {
"control": { "model": "gpt-4o", "deployment": "gpt4o-prod", "weight": 80 },
"treatment": { "model": "gpt-4o-2025-04", "deployment": "gpt4o-canary", "weight": 20 }
},
"sticky_assignment": true,
"assignment_key": "user_id",
"metrics_to_track": ["groundedness", "relevance", "latency_ms", "token_count"]
}
}Sticky assignment ensures the same user always hits the same model during the experiment, preventing inconsistent experiences mid-conversation.

token_delta_pct = round((canary_tokens_avg - prod_tokens_avg) / prod_tokens_avg * 100, 1)A canary is promoted to production only when ALL pass:
| Metric | Threshold | Measurement Window |
|---|---|---|
| Request success rate | ≥99.5% | 30 min rolling |
| p99 latency | ≤500ms (or ≤110% of baseline) | 30 min rolling |
| Groundedness score | ≥4.0 (absolute) and ≤10% regression | 2 hour rolling |
| Relevance score | ≥4.0 | 2 hour rolling |
| Token consumption | ≤120% of baseline | 1 hour rolling |
| Content safety flags | 0 high-severity | Entire canary window |
| Error rate | <0.5% | 30 min rolling |
If any metric breaches its threshold for 3 consecutive intervals, Flagger triggers automatic rollback. Manual override requires on-call approval via PagerDuty acknowledge.
